AREA Hillview Road Fairview Drive is positioned on Hollybank, a popular & established residential area, within catchment for the favoured local schools, on the outskirts of Hythe Village. This means all the amenities offered by the village centre are within easy reach and these include a range of shops, bars and restaurants, a passenger ferry service from Hythe pier to Southampton, along with bus services to many other areas. Proximity to both The New Forest National Park and The Solent enables many outside interests to be enjoyed and there is a recreation centre at Applemore and Gang Warily, a golf course at Dibden, an activity centre at Calshot Beach and a Country Park at Lepe.
